What Causes Swelling In Ankles And Feet With History Of Tooth Decay?
I was told a few months back i had to have a tooth removed cause the cavity was eating my tooth away, its more than a few a months an my ankles an feet have been swelling, i didnt have it removed yet, could this tooth ache and rot be causing this swelling?
I have gone through your query and can understand your concern...
As per your query tooth decay has not been seem to cause swelling in the ankles and feet as in case of tooth decay swelling can be seen over the jaw and face which can even extend towards upper part of neck and lymph nodes but does not cause swelling over the ankles and feet.. For tooth related issues if you are advised extraction better get it done otherwise the infection can lead to cellulitis and space infections and can become fatal..
In case of swelling over the ankles and feet there can be multiple causes like Lymphadema, infections, heart, liver or kidney disease, thyroid problems etc and you should consult an Orthopaedician and get evaluated and treatment can be planned once the diagnosis is confirmed after thorough clinical evaluation and laboratory investigations if needed..
